Compare Sacramento to Lodi

This post compares Sacramento, California to Lodi,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Sacramento (city) Lodi (city)
Population 489,650 64,403
Income (median) $46,110 $42,478
Home Value (median) $287,600 $269,400
White 48% 64%
Black 13% 1%
Asian 18% 8%
With Kids 31% 37%
Age (median) 34 34
Rentals 52% 46%
